Day 1Welcome to CopenhagenHans Christian Andersen would have been right at home in 21st-century Copenhagen. The Danish capital hasn't lost any of its fairy-tale charm over the centuries, as you'll come to discover on your first day exploring this colorful city. Start your Scandinavian adventure with your Travel Director and fellow travelers, and enjoy dinner together to kick things off.

Day 2Explore Historic CopenhagenConnect with the heartfelt hygge of your Danish hosts when you join a Local Specialist this morning for a sightseeing tour that will reveal all the highlights of Copenhagen’s Old Town. See Christiansborg Palace and the Little Mermaid, demurely seated on a rock overlooking Langelinie Promenade. See the home of Denmark’s beloved royal family, Amalienborg Palace, then spend the rest of the day exploring Copenhagen your way. Enjoy a cold øl overlooking the colorful façades of Nyhavn.

Day 3Journey to OsloCopenhagenFor now, it’s a fond farvel to Copenhagen and a bright and cheery hej to Sweden, as you cross the Øresund by ferry and wind your way north, through the Swedish countryside to Norway. You’ll want to keep your camera at the ready to capture the scenic landscapes that line your route to Oslo, Norway’s modern buzzing capital, where the Norwegian philosophy of friluftsliv can be felt along the flower-lined boulevards and bustling waterfront promenades.

Day 4Vikings and More in OsloTread in the footsteps of the Vikings this morning as you join your Local Specialist for a sightseeing tour that will reveal Oslo’s long-standing seafaring heritage. See the medieval fortress of Akershus, the elegant Royal Palace and Oslo Opera House, which seems to rise up from the water in all its marble, granite and glass glory. Visit a wonderland of Norwegian sculptures left behind by Gustav Vigeland in his sculpture park, then enjoy a free afternoon to explore the city on your terms. You could choose instead to embark on an optional experience to explore Oslo in more depth.

Day 5Onwards to StockholmEnjoy a scenic drive south through Norway’s lush forest landscapes to Sweden, bound for its enchanting capital. Journey past Lake Vänern, the largest lake in Sweden, before stopping in the countryside to Connect With Locals at a special Be My Guest experience with lunch. Brother and sister Niklas and Anna will welcome you to their renovated 19th-century venue and share their philosophy of using local produce to delight all your senses. Later, arrive in Stockholm and enjoy a free evening to explore ‘Beauty on Water’. Consider joining an Optional Experience at the first Ice Bar in the world.

Day 6Discover Beautiful StockholmStyle and substance are qualities Stockholm has in abundance, as you’ll discover when you join your Local Specialist for a sightseeing tour this morning. See Stockholm’s historic mother church, Storkyrkan, the Royal Palace and the Swedish Parliament, then Dive Into Culture on a visit to the City Hall, home to the annual Nobel Prize banquet. This afternoon perhaps join an Optional Experience to explore the maritime heritage of the city, or simply do as the locals do and indulge in fika (coffee and cake), embracing the Swedish philosophy of lagom. Tonight consider an optional experience to cobbled Gamla Stan to admire its medieval history on a walking tour, followed by a traditional Swedish meal in a local restaurant.

Day 7Embark on an Overnight CruiseHelsinkiA leisurely start to your day could see you embark on some last-minute souvenir shopping or savoring steaming sweet Swedish cinnamon rolls in Stortoget. Consider an optional experience to Drottningholm Palace. The cool capital of Finland beckons as you board your overnight cruise to Helsinki, passing through Stockholm’s archipelago across the Baltic Sea.

Day 8Arrive in Vibrant HelsinkiContinue your cruise across the Baltic, arriving in Helsinki in time to join your Local Specialist for a sightseeing tour of all the city’s highlights, its Swedish and Russian heritage and some hidden gems. See the modern marble façades of Finlandia Hall, the Senate and the colorful stalls in Market Square. This evening, join your fellow travelers for dinner to raise a glass and toast your epic adventure across the capitals of Scandinavia. Kippis!

Day 9Helsinki at LeisureToday is yours to explore Helsinki at leisure or perhaps consider joining a full-day optional experience to cruise to the beautiful capital of Estonia, Tallinn. With its walled, cobblestoned Old Town, you will feel like you've stepped into the pages of a fairytale.
